A leader in international education and a global brand with a prestigious array of digital / EdTech products for all school subject areas, and all levels, is seeking a Curriculum Specialist to join their EMEA publishing team, working hybrid from their London office (2 days/week in office). The company offer an excellent salary, great benefits and a collaborative and inclusive working culture.

The main remit of the Curriculum Specialist will be to demonstrate and outline both internally across the team, and externally to educators and school stakeholders, how and why their products can help them succeed in the classroom. You will align the product portfolio with key global curricula and ensure effective communication across sales, marketing, and customer channels. With an understanding of international curriculum frameworks, strong presentation skills, and the ability to train and support internal teams and external clients, the specialist will be responsible for staying informed about new technology trends in education and bringing innovative ideas to enhance the company's product offering. Your varied and pivotal role will involve being responsible for:

  • Product strategy and communication
  • Curriculum alignment
  • Sales and marketing enablement
  • Product presentations to sales teams
  • Professional development course management
  • Customer product training

This rewarding role that would suit someone who thrives in an environment of ownership and accountability and who has strong knowledge of global curricula (IB, Cambridge, Common Core/NGSS, British), and excellent presentation skills. The Curriculum Specialist will be customer-focused and have the ability to develop creative solutions and manage complex priorities in a fast-paced environment. Proven experience in product positioning and strategy within the education sector would be highly valuable, alongside teaching experience in an international school setting.
